Like Rivals, Goldman Sachs Boosts Junior Banker Salaries
-Recent college graduates will now start around $110,000 as an annual base salary.
-The bump comes after a report compiled by analysts detailed long hours and burnout during a big year. Rivals had seized on the controversy by poaching top performers.

Citizens Financial to Buy Investors Bancorp in $3.5 Billion Deal
-The deal, announced last week, is the latest in a series of regional bank tie-ups. It comes after Citizens previously announced it will buy 80 East coast branches and the online deposit business of HSBS Holdings PLC.
-In the New York metropolitan area, Citizens expects to become one of the top 10 largest depository banks and compete for some of the regions most affluent customers.
